Purvis is returning to Watchung with her saxophonist husband Bob Ackerman. This dynamic duo will perform at the center on Sept. 22 at 8 p.m. They last performed there almost one year ago. Purvis and Ackerman themselves, however, have been performing together for over 25 years.
The two first met while Purvis was performing at Gulliverâ in West Paterson. They have worked together incessantly, both onstage and off, practically every day and night since! In performing together all this time, the two have developed a style that is uniquely all their own.
“Purvis and Ackerman emanate a harmonic style reminiscent of Lester Young and Billie Holiday,”says Rosalind Picou of Jazz Now magazine. “Purvis’s voice follows Ackerman’s full-bodied horn with authoritative harmony and absolute charm.”
Purvis’s concerts at the center always contain elements of surprise and humor! She is a vivacious performer who is at her best in front of an intimate live audience. For her return to the center, Purvis will be performing a concert entitled ˜My Favorite Songs.” This concert will consist of, (what else?), her favorite songs! The songs she has chosen include not only popular standards from the great American songbook, but also some selections audiences might not expect.
